Zagrebenje bunker maze

 

Croatian islands have had a military past. During World War II when Tito held his headquarters on the island of Vis. After the war, Vis was turned into a defense bastion, and only opened for foreigners as late as in 1989. Today we toured a maze of tunnels on the Zagrebenje mountains on the southeast corner of the island, connecting a number gun positions. 

There are also many other similar setups around the island. These gun positions are common. For other types of military relics, I've visited for instance, the abandoned missile base, the mountainside tunnels, or the underground submarine base. But I'm sure there's tons more!
